While Zydn might be mastering baby steps, his dad’s recent Instagram story showcased something all parents resonate with. A delightful play session with little Zydn had a caption warning of the toddler’s new-found skill: mimicry. “At the stage where u gotta be careful what u say cause it can be repeated,” he noted.

Away from daddy duties, OBJ is preparing for a major comeback. Signing with the Baltimore Ravens, Beckham has already left a mark in the preseason games, hinting at a promising season ahead. His sharpness in training camp, even after recovering from an ACL injury, speaks volumes about his dedication.

Beckham’s highly anticipated return in the Week 1 game against the Houston Texans is not just about his football prowess. It reflects his undying spirit to rise from setbacks, be it an injury on the field or the challenges of fatherhood.
